If you do not …Locate an active mole runway by pressing down on raised ridges of soil. The next day, note which ridges have been raised again. Then depress the ridge of soil and set the trap over it; the mole ...There are two types of moles active in Michigan; eastern moles and star-nosed moles. The eastern mole is the mole that creates surface tunnels all over the place. The star-nosed mole is the mole that forms the big piles or volcanoes of soil on the surface. The best defense against moles is a good offense, according to Niewold. "Dig at least 12 inches underground and burry a mesh fence ," he suggests, adding that the bottom of this fence should be bent away from your garden in the shape of an L; this will send moles scurrying in a different direction.

Feb 20, 2024 · Benefits of Moles in your Lawn. A mole’s tunneling aerates and loosens the soil, which helps plant growth. They eat garden pests and are themselves a food source for foxes and other predators. Moles are often blamed for eating bulbs and the fleshy roots of ornamentals, but chipmunks, mice, and voles are actually the culprits.

Voles are different from moles in that they are herbivores. They are small, stout rodents slightly larger than a field mouse. They are brown to gray in color, 4 to 6 inches long, with large front teeth used for chewing through bark and roots. Moles do not have these large front teeth.

Although moles do not eat plants or plant roots, they can cause severe damage to lawns due to the tunnels they dig. A mole's front feet are their hallmark feature: they are oversized, with paddle-like hands and large claws that help them dig and move quickly through the soil. Moles are brown to dark gray, with soft fur. They have long snouts, protruding about an inch from their faces. They are small, only about 6 to 8 inches long and weigh less than a pound.
